#nav {position: absolute; top:0; left:0;}
#nav, #nav ul{ font-size: 12px; font-family: "Lucida Grande arial" arial; line-height: 1.5; list-style: none; margin: 0; padding: 0; clear: left; border-width: 0 }
#nav li      {  margin: 0; padding: 0; position: relative; width: 90px; float: left; }
#nav a 			 { color: #fff; text-decoration: none; text-align: left; display: block; border-width: 0 }
#nav li a    { background-color: #444; margin: 0; padding: 0 0px 0 5px; border-style: solid; border-width: 1px; border-color: #999 #000 #000 #999; display:block;}
#nav li ul   { line-height: 1.25; display: block; margin: 0; padding: 0; position: absolute; left: -999em; width: 90px; border-width: 0 }
#nav li ul li{ font-size: 12px; width: 90px;  margin-top:0px;}
#nav li:hover ul, #nav li.sfhover ul  {left: auto; }
#nav .space { background-color: #900; width: 0; border-width: 0 }
li#current a   { font-weight:normal;}
ul#station li a{ background-color:#aaf;}
ul#church li a { background-color:#c79cff;}
ul#busy li a   { background-color:#ffd760;}
ul#link li a   { background-color:#6c8;}
ul#main li a   { background-color:#6c8;}
li#rec { width:135px;}   
#nav li ul li a {color:#000; border-left-width:1px; border-color:#222; border-top-width:0;display:block;}
#pagetitle{ margin-top:20px;}
